Sometimes 'bugs' that are visible on substrate are an indication of poor water quality - this can also exacerbate your fish's condition, whatever it is that caused the fin damage. Be careful not to overfeed, and do regular water changes, vacuuming your substrate if needed. What kind of tank do you have? What's your cleaning schedule like?
